Disable keyboard sound in Linux: step-by-step guide

There are times when the keyboard sound in Linux can be annoying, whether when typing quickly or in quiet environments. Fortunately, disabling this feature is quite simple. Follow this step-by-step guide to disable the keyboard sound on your Linux system.

1. First, open the terminal by pressing Ctrl + Alt⁤ + T or find the terminal in the applications menu.
2. Once in the terminal, use the ‌ command xset q to view the current keyboard settings. You will be able to observe information such as autorepeat delay, rate and bell feedback.
3. To turn off the keyboard sound, use the command⁤ xset b off. This will disable the “beep” sound that occurs when pressing incorrect keys.
4.‍ To make sure the settings are maintained after rebooting the system, you can add the xset b off command to the file .bashrc o .bash_profile in‌ your home directory.

And that's it! With these ⁢simple steps, you can disable the keyboard sound ⁤on your Linux system. Now you can write without interruptions or auditory interference. Remember that if you want to re-enable the keyboard sound in the future, you just have to follow the same steps but using the command xset ‍b on.
